Interview: KAP Games on Web3 distribution, development, and publishing

Game Daily

KAP Games is a distribution and publishing platform that can best be described as a kind of Steam for Web3 browser and mobile games. It is currently listing more than 50 games including a number of first party titles, such as Brawl of Fame. “With our platform, we make it as easy as jumping onto Netflix.
